Accept defeat and work with Delta Governor-Elect; Uviejitobor urges Omo-Agege, other guber candidates

L-R: Hon Peter Uviejitobor and Delta State Governor-Elect, Rt Hon Sheriff Oborevwori

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on LinkedinShare on Whatsapp

The member representing Udu Constituency in the Delta State House of Assembly, Hon Peter Uviejitobor has felicitated with the State Governor-elect, Rt Hon Sheriff Oborevwori, and the Deputy Governor-elect, Sir Monday Onyeme for the victory last Saturday’s gubernatorial election in the state.

Hon Uviejitobor in a statement on behalf of family and constituents also felicitated Governor Ifeanyi Okowa and the PDP family for the landslide victory of the candidate of the party in the 2023 governorship race in the state.

The lawmaker stated that the PDP candidate winning 21 out of the 25 local government areas in the state and leaving behind his closet rival with over 120,000 votes margin was colossal and commended Deltans for voting massively for Sheriff Oborevwori who is the Speaker of the State Assembly.

Saying that Deltans have again proven the dominance of PDP in the state, Hon Uviejitobor emphasized that at no time would lies, bitterness, propaganda and evil machinations triumph over the will of God.

The Udu lawmaker who is the Chairman of, the Assembly Committee on Water Resources Development, maintained that Deltans had made the right choice for the state and commended the people for believing in PDP.

Uviejitobor expressed optimism that the Governor-elect, would sustain the enviable legacies of the outgoing administration in the state, and prayed to God to grant him and his deputy the wherewithal to pilot the affairs of the state to enviable heights.

“I thank God for granting the prayers of Deltans. The people have chosen the Right Honorable Speaker of the Delta Assembly to lead them in the next four years. I must congratulate my dear colleague, friend and Governor-elect, Rt Hon Sheriff Oborevwori, and his Deputy, Sir Monday John Onyeme on the well-deserved victory.

“2023 Delta State Governorship election has been concluded and the winner has emerged. I pray God blesses the winner with good health and wisdom for the task ahead. I commend Deltans for standing solidly with the PDP,” Uviejitobor stated.

The Udu lawmaker urged candidates of the other seventeen political parties that contested the governorship election to accept the outcome and work with Oborevwori towards moving the state to the next level of development.

“I want to enjoin the candidates of all political parties that contested the gubernatorial election in Delta State to embrace the outcome of the election. In every contest, there must be a winner. Sheriff has emerged. I am aware that some of the Governorship candidates have already congratulated him. That is the spirit and I expect all others to follow the same path as it leads to more stability in the polity and peace in the state,” Uviejitobor emphasized.

The lawmaker assured that together with other critical stakeholders, PDP in Udu will regain all lost glory in the local government area.
